Golden Retriever Was Duck’s Favorite Perch as a Duckling & Nothing Has Changed

There’s nothing more heart-melting than witnessing a beautiful friendship full of trust form between a dog and another animal. This video captured a charming Golden Retriever named Poe being the favorite perch for his duck friend since the duckling days.

On September 10, the owner took to Instagram to post the video through the account @poethegoldie. The Reel has begun to receive a lot of attention from viewers on the social media platform since then.

Duck still stands on Golden Retriever’s side, just as he did as a duckling

An adorable video on Instagram showed a duck standing on top of a Golden Retriever named Poe, just as he used to do as a duckling. The Reel has been winning hearts on the internet, as people are in love with the duck and the pup’s special connection. In the caption of the post, the owner wrote, “Our duck’s trust for Poe is max level.”

The Instagram video started by giving a closer look at Poe, the Golden Retriever, taking a peaceful nap. In the meantime, the duck, who was just a little duckling at the time, was standing right on top of the fur baby. The text written over the clip read, “Our duck liked to stand on our dog since day 1.”

As the video continued, viewers could see the duckling still standing on top of the dog as they grew up. “Completely safe up there,” read the text. The Reel then jumped to a clip showing the duck standing on top of Poe even when he was completely grown up. The duck’s love and trust for the fur baby is truly undeniable, and it will surely bring a smile to anyone’s face.

In the comments section, one fan wrote, “Omg so cute.” “This is everything,” gushed another.
